Mississippi Personal Injury Laws Tourists Should Know
If you’re a tourist hurt in Mississippi, learning about the state’s personal injury laws is key. It’s not just about knowing your rights. It’s also about understanding the legal system in a place that’s not your home.
3-Year Statute of Limitations for Filing Claims
In Mississippi, you have three years from the accident date to file a claim. This statute of limitations is very important. If you miss this deadline, your claim might be thrown out.

Mississippi’s Pure Comparative Negligence Rule
Mississippi uses a pure comparative negligence rule. This means your award can be cut by how much you’re at fault. For example, if you’re 20% at fault, you get 80% of the damages.
- If you’re found 0% at fault, you get 100% of the damages.
- If you’re found 50% at fault, you get 50% of the damages.
- If you’re found 100% at fault, you get 0% of the damages.
This rule shows why having a good lawyer is so important. They can help lower your fault percentage.
Damage Caps in Mississippi Personal Injury Cases
Mississippi doesn’t cap damages in most personal injury cases. But, there are some exceptions, like cases against the government.
For example, claims against the State of Mississippi or its political subdivisions have a $500,000 cap on damages. This cap doesn’t include interest and costs.

Gathering Evidence for Your Biloxi Personal Injury Claim
To build a strong personal injury claim in Biloxi, you need to collect evidence from the accident scene. As a tourist, knowing what evidence to gather is key. Make sure to collect and save it before you leave Biloxi.
Important Documents to Collect Before Leaving Biloxi
Collecting important documents is a critical step. These documents include:
- Police reports or incident reports from the accident site
- Medical records and bills from your treatment
- Receipts for any injury-related expenses, like transportation or medication
- Insurance information, including your own and the at-fault party’s
Keep these documents organized and safe. They are vital for your personal injury claim.
Witness Statements from Fellow Tourists and Locals
Witness statements are valuable for your claim. If people saw your accident, get their contact info and a statement. Take their names, phone numbers, and a brief description of what they saw. You can also ask them to write a statement or testify for you.
Witness statements can prove liability and strengthen your claim. Get them as soon as you can, while their memories are fresh.

Compensation Available for Injured Tourists in Mississippi
Injured tourists in Mississippi can seek compensation for their losses. It’s important to know the types of damages you can claim to recover your losses.
Medical Expenses and Ongoing Treatment
Medical expenses are a key part of compensation for injured tourists. This includes emergency treatment and ongoing care. Medical expenses cover hospital stays, surgeries, physical therapy, and necessary equipment or prescriptions.
Lost Wages and Vacation Time Reimbursement
Tourists may also get compensation for lost wages or vacation time. If you had to miss work or cut your trip short, you can claim for it. This is very important for those who are self-employed or have limited vacation time.
Pain and Suffering Damages Under Mississippi Law
Mississippi law also covers pain and suffering damages. This non-economic damage is for the physical and emotional distress from the injury. The amount for pain and suffering varies based on the injury’s severity and life impact.
